To Rationalize the denominator of 5-√7/9-√14.
To rationalize this we multiply both the denominator and denominator by the conjugate of the denominator.
The denominator is 9-√14 and its conjugate is (9+√14).
(5-√7)/(9-√14) = (5-√7)(9+√14)/(9-√14)(9+√14)
= (5-√7)(9+√14)/(9²-14)
= (45 + 5√14 - 9√7 - √98)/(81-14)
= (45 + 5√14 - 9√7 - √98)/67
= (45 + 5√14 - 9√7 - 7√2)67
This is the rationalized expression.
